Roscoe Smith latest to leave UConn

First Alex Oriakhi transferred. Then Jeremy Lamb and Andre Drummond bolted for the NBA. Now Roscoe Smith is also leaving UConn.

Smith's father told CBSSports.com on Saturday morning that his son, a sophomore forward for the Huskies, will leave the program and has received his release.

The 6-foot-8 Smith averaged 4.4 points in 18.7 minutes this past season, which was down from 6.3 points and 25.4 minutes his freshman campaign.

UConn could be painfully thin this season, one in which they likely won't be allowed to participate in the NCAA tournament, anyway.

The Huskies return guards Shabazz Napier and Ryan Boatright, but don't have much up front. Michael Bradley also transferred, but UConn still has Tyler Olander and Enosch Wolf -- who barely played last season.

UConn is also expected to have Niels Giffey, DeAndre Daniels, signee Omar Calhoun and one-year Holy Cross transfer R.J. Evans.
